Thupten Last Name Facts
Where Does The Last Name Thupten Come From? nationality or country of origin
The surname Thupten (Hindi: थुप्तेन, Tibetan: ཐུགས་རྟེན་) is held by more people in India than any other country/territory. It can also occur in the variant forms:. Click here to see other possible spellings of this name.
How Common Is The Last Name Thupten? popularity and diffusion
This surname is the 1,504,764th most commonly used surname on a global scale, borne by approximately 1 in 52,428,388 people. This surname occurs mostly in Asia, where 66 percent of Thupten live; 62 percent live in South Asia and 61 percent live in Indo-South Asia. It is also the 258,233rd most prevalent first name at a global level, borne by 974 people.
The surname is most commonly held in India, where it is held by 84 people, or 1 in 9,131,731. In India Thupten is primarily found in: Arunachal Pradesh, where 77 percent live, Delhi, where 6 percent live and Meghalaya, where 6 percent live. Excluding India it occurs in 10 countries. It is also found in The United States, where 19 percent live and Belgium, where 10 percent live.
